Photos View of Downtown London Ontario from River Forks Park By Jim Eadie - May 25, 2016 0 1844 Facebook Twitter Pinterest WhatsApp A view of Downtown London Ontario from River Forks Park along the beautiful Thames River, you can see the blue “Twin Tower” buildings in the middle of the photo. > Comments comments